Upgrade Your Road Trips with the Perfect Standard Size Rental Car!

So how does upgrading actually improve the trip? Standard rental cars offer ample space without sacrificing agility. They fit comfortably in city traffic, allow easy parking in tight lots, and deliver updated safety features increasingly expected in modern fleets. Without the bulk of a SUV, drivers navigate highways and side roads with confidence. For road trippers, this means less distraction, more focus on the journey, and fewer surprises at traffic or terrain changes. Factual benefits like stronger fuel economy and broader availability across popular rental hubs enhance accessibility, turning the standard model into a smart, reliable choice.

This isn’t about luxury or excess—it’s about matching your ride to the real demands of traveling across cities, scenic routes, and spontaneous detours. The standard size strikes a balance, offering maneuverability in urban areas while providing enough space for comfort, luggage, and shared travel needs. For many, switching from a compact to a standard model transforms a routine trip into a more intuitive, stress-free adventure.
